Anxiety, disruptive,
eating, mood, and substance use
disorders were assessed during adolescence and early adulthood using the Diagnostic Interview Schedule for Children.36 The parent and offspring
versions of the Diagnostic Interview Schedule for Children were administered during the adolescent interviews because the use
of multiple informants increases the reliability and validity
of psychiatric diagnoses among adolescents.37, 38 Symptoms were considered present if reported by either informant.
